Bagbag Bridge
Bagbag Bridge is a bridge in Bulacan, Central Luzon. Bagbag Bridge is situated nearby to the church Santo Nino Quasi Parish, as well as near Sta. Cruz Chapel.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Calumpit Church
Church
Photo: Judgefloro, Public domain.
The Diocesan Shrine and Parish of Saint John the Baptist, also known as the San Juan Bautista Parish Church and commonly known as Calumpit Church, is a 17th-century, Roman Catholic, baroque church located in Calumpit, Bulacan, Philippines. Calumpit Church is situated 1½ km northwest of Bagbag Bridge.

Apalit
Town
Photo: Ramon FVelasquez,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Apalit, officially the Municipality of Apalit, is a municipality in the province of Pampanga, Philippines. According to the 2020 census, it has a population of 117,160 people. Apalit is situated 5 km north of Bagbag Bridge.
Macabebe
Town
Photo: Ramon FVelasquez,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Macabebe, officially the Municipality of Macabebe, is a municipality in the province of Pampanga, Philippines. According to the 2020 census, it has a population of 78,151 people. Macabebe is situated 7 km west of Bagbag Bridge.
